The FBI is offering a reward of up to $25,000 for information leading to the identification, arrest, and conviction of those responsible for the murder of Nicholas Jasiel.
Jasiel, 19, was shot and killed on December 7, 2019, at approximately 9:00 p.m., while standing in the street at the corner of Dwight Avenue and Mallory Road in the Hillcrest section of Ramapo. Authorities are urging anyone with knowledge of the incident to come forward.
